  6. Rapid City, SD is still on. They are working on having events *at* Crazy
    Horse and Mt. Rushmore, so seeing those famous sites won't be required
    outside the convention schedule. Hopefully some time will be set aside
    to enjoy them also, but those convention schedules have a way of
    getting tight!

    Again, this is a MUni-loving group, and they expect to offer plenty of
    that for us. Dates still projected in the July 5-12 range, though
    possibly one day shorter.

    For 2009, there are discussions about going back to Toronto! Not yet
    confirmed, but the Toronto Unicycle Club, with their biggest NAUCC
    turnout ever (20 riders plus families) seems serious on planning it.

    Who wants to host 2010?
